Once you upgrade your BlackBerry Z30 to 10.3.3 version, you will not be able to downgrade back to a lower OS version (such as 10.3.2 or 10.2.1). This is a deliberate restriction built into the bootloader by BlackBerry. Before proceeding, be absolutely certain that you want to move permanently to 10.3.3.
